首页 - 应用性能监控软件

最佳应用性能监控软件

IT行业的性能和增长在很大程度上依赖于良好的应用程序监控工具,这些工具负责管理组织的整个应用程序基础架构。几十年来,IT系统一直在向系统管理员提供数据,以帮助识别问题并控制一切。

开发人员构建了应用程序性能监控工具来监视应用程序行为。拥有有效的APM软件不仅可以控制时间延迟,还可以通过识别和修复系统中的任何错误来提高公司的绩效。从长远来看,有缺陷的系统永远不会值得信赖,并且会严重影响客户忠诚度和员工生产力。逐渐地,组织正在采取更多转型计划来促进业务增长,例如容器编排、云迁移和其他微服务。所有应用程序都依赖于多种硬件和软件才能正常运行,因此,一个高效的APM监控软件必须能够跨越所有边界并提供对最终用户体验的详细分析。IT部门承受着巨大的压力,需要发挥最大的作用。

应用性能监控软件的功能

在当今不断增长的经济需求中,故障系统和性能延迟不是商业企业的选择。即时通知和问题修复对于任何组织的长期维持都至关重要。因此,APM平台的需求和受欢迎程度与日俱增。其主要特点包括:

Web请求和事务性能:APM工具使用户能够跟踪应用程序中每个事务和Web请求的性能。这有助于了解哪些Web请求最慢,哪些应该改进,哪些被查看最多。

真实用户监控:如今,大多数应用程序使用大量Javascript,这使得用户必须监控网页完全加载以及呈现网页所需的持续时间。在这种情况下,真正的用户监控成为APM的一个基本功能,它可以帮助用户彻底分析和监控应用程序。理想的APM平台还将评估特定用户是否可以随时随地访问应用程序提供的所有工具和资源。

代码级性能分析:当系统无法正常工作时,了解问题的根本原因至关重要,其中一种常见的方法是从代码级分析错误。APM软件可帮助用户在代码级别跟踪应用程序性能,并更好地了解原因并相应地修复问题。

为什么要使用应用性能监控软件?

一个应用性能监控平台负责检测和报告性能错误,以确保服务顺利运行并保证客户满意度。因此,任何行业要想成功生存,都需要有效的APM软件来分析和提高性能。系统中未安装APM工具可防止突出显示问题,这会导致性能延迟,有时由于长时间未被注意而导致的错误无法再次修复。此外,一旦检测到任何错误,APM工具就会立即以通知的形式向用户发送警报。除了检测和修复错误外,该软件还有助于增强最终用户体验,可以部署在各种生产环境中并管理多种形式的技术。全面的,APM解决方案以实时监控和强大的报告而著称,不仅可以立即查明错误,还可以在用户遇到系统故障和性能问题之前解决问题。因此,每个组织都必须实施有效的APM应用程序,以大幅提高生产力和性能。

应用性能监控软件的好处

可以从APM平台获得大量选项,以下是它们带来的许多好处的简要列表:

降低收入风险:客户忠诚度是任何公司维持自身发展的最重要因素。如今,经济需求旺盛,因此无法选择失去客户。例如,在购物狂潮的节日期间,有缺陷的电子商务系统将导致销售额下降。在这种情况下,APM软件有助于在问题影响客户之前快速识别问题并修复它们。

提高业务连续性:停机对任何企业来说都是最糟糕的情况,因为它可能导致收入损失和声誉受损,以及生产力下降和客户满意度下降。组织投资于APM服务,因为它通过有效地排除错误以及升级和更改应用程序的内部基础架构来提高业务连续性的水平。

增强的客户体验:APM有助于提高客户忠诚度和满意度。通过实时监控和识别错误,APM使公司能够通过提高生产力和性能在竞争中保持领先地位,从而使客户不受问题的影响。

促进创新:没有哪个行业喜欢处理大量的消防演习。APM工具促进与应用程序开发、运营和DevOps等不同部门的主动知识交流和协作。因此,无需进行微不足道的消防演习,即可更迅速地解决反复出现的问题。

高谷歌排名:该软件最大的好处之一是它总是帮助应用程序在谷歌搜索结果页面上排名更高。如果特定应用程序在改善最终用户体验的情况下运行良好,则该应用程序有望在搜索结果中排名靠前,从而提升品牌声誉。

服务器监控:如今应用程序问题非常普遍,在某些情况下,监控内存和CPU也变得至关重要。使用APM服务,用户可以修复与服务器CPU和其他指标有关的错误。

谁在使用应用性能监控软件?

IT团队:应用程序性能的监控在系统管理和信息技术领域至关重要,因为性能是维持品牌忠诚度和客户满意度的最重要因素。性能中断是IT团队必须防止的一个主要缺点,以避免丢失客户。APM服务提供真实用户监控,这有助于识别网页的加载速度。如果网页速度很慢,它会自动影响需要检查的应用程序性能。此外,开发人员可以利用这些工具来监控访问或查看最多的网页,并基于此,可以相应地改进营销和业务策略。

购买应用性能监控工具考虑的因素

APM软件可以预先检测管理系统中的问题,从而防止可能损害公司声誉的长期错误。每个行业都使用在各种类型的硬件和软件上运行的不同类型的系统。因此,在用户开始使用APM工具之前,了解公司的需求以及该软件如何使他们受益非常重要。本基本指南重点介绍了购买者在购买适合其业务的APM软件之前需要考虑的几个重要方面。

类型和功能:APM生态系统非常复杂,因此在使用该软件之前,了解其不同类别的功能非常重要。要知道的最重要的一点是它支持哪种类型的监控软件。有些支持综合监控,这意味着它们分析应用程序行为以识别潜在威胁并优化性能。其他人根据从真实用户收集的数据执行真实用户监控。许多工具都可以同时支持。

事务性能跟踪:一些APM工具执行事务跟踪,它提供有关应用程序中特定操作的详细信息。开发人员以前使用此技术来识别应用程序错误,这些错误现在已成为此类软件的一个重要功能,因为它可以帮助系统管理员找出系统的特定部分无法正常运行的原因。

成本分析:近年来,开发人员开始提供APM软件的另一个重要功能,称为成本分析。此功能可通过识别未充分利用的系统(例如在云上运行且不再连接任何应用程序的数据量)来帮助组织避免不必要的基础架构成本。

自动响应:APM工具最有趣的功能之一是自动响应,它使用机器学习在检测到系统中的问题时采取行动。但是自动响应不能像人类管理员一样解决所有问题,但它们可以帮助管理员解决无法自动解决的更复杂的问题。

更新日期: 2021-08-02 08:52:45